شاطّهُIII
, Verbal.Noun مُشَاطَّةٌ, He vied with him in
اِشْتِطَاط [i. e. going far, or beyond the due bounds, in offering a thing for sale and demanding a price for it, or in bargaining for a thing; or acting unjustly, wrongfully, injuriously, or tyrannically, in judging, &c.]. You say, شاطّهُ [He vied with him in so doing, and surpassed him, or overcame him, therein]. See also 1, in the latter half of the paragraph.
